Latest Patents
One of Bernier's latest patents is focused on the control of semiconductor manufacturing equipment in mixed reality environments. This innovative platform allows for the operation of semiconductor manufacturing tools within a mixed reality setting, enhancing the way data is displayed and interacted with. The system includes an MR control platform and an MR headset, which work together to provide real-time operational information and control features in an immersive environment. Another notable patent is for a knurling edge driving tool, designed to drive components with a knurling pattern. This tool features a shaft that engages with the knurling pattern, allowing for efficient rotation of the component when the shaft is turned.
